
Rachel Wagner-Kaiser, Ph.D., is a director and data scientist at KPMG. She has 15 years of experience in data and AI, and specializes in building AI and natural language processing solutions for real-world problems constrained by limited or messy data. Rachel works across industries to lead KPMG’s technical teams to design, build, deploy, and maintain NLP solutions. Her expertise has helped companies organize and decode their unstructured data to solve a variety of business problems and drive value through automation. She is also author of the upcoming book “Teaching Computers to Read”.
